This is due to adenine introduced into the new DNA strand is unmethylated. Re-methylation takes place within two to 4 seconds, for the duration of which era replication faults in The brand new strand are repaired. Methylation, or its absence, is definitely the marker which allows the mend apparatus of your cell to differentiate in between the template and nascent strands. It has been demonstrated that altering Dam exercise in microbes leads to an elevated spontaneous mutation level. Bacterial viability is compromised in dam mutants that also lack selected other DNA fix enzymes, providing further evidence for that purpose of Dam in DNA repair service.

SeqA binds on the origin of replication, sequestering it and thus stopping methylation. due to the fact hemimethylated origins of replication are inactive, this mechanism boundaries DNA replication to the moment for every cell cycle.

The restriction enzyme DpnI can realize five'-GmeATC-three' web-sites and digest the methylated DNA. remaining these a short motif, it takes place regularly in sequences by chance, and as such its Main use for researchers will be to degrade template DNA next PCRs (PCR products and solutions deficiency methylation, as no methylases are present in the response).

Representation of a DNA molecule that is definitely methylated. The 2 white spheres depict methyl groups. They're sure to two cytosine nucleotide molecules which make up the DNA sequence. DNA methylation is usually a Organic course of action by which methyl groups are included on the DNA molecule. Methylation can alter the activity of the DNA section without having altering the sequence.
